Xiaomi Redmi 9 Power design leaked ahead of launch in India on December 17

Xiaomi Redmi 9 Power is set to launch on December 17 in India and a new leak has revealed the design of the upcoming phone. Xiaomi has been teasing the Redmi 9 Power from quite some time now across its social media handles and on its dedicated microsite. The Redmi 9 Power is rumoured to be based on the Redmi Note 9 4G that was launched in November in China alongside the Redmi Note 9 5G and Redmi Note 9 Pro 5G.

As per an image leaked by 91Mobiles in collaboration with Ishan Agarwal, the Redmi 9 Power is slated to feature quad cameras on the back. The design is very much in line with the Redmi Note 9 4G except the fourth camera. This is rumoured to be a macro camera

Moreover, the phone is set to available in four colourways-- black, blue, red and green. The leaked image gives us a glimpse of the blue colour variant of the Redmi 9 Power that has a textured finish with a vertical camera array in the top-left corner.

The Redmi 9 Power is scheduled to launch a day after the company unveils its Mi QLED TV in India. Another report reveals that Xiaomi might be planning to launch the Redmi Note 9 Pro 5G in India as the Mi 10i, as the latter was spotted in a Geekbench listing. If the fourth camera does turn out to be macro while the rest of the specifications remain identical to the Redmi Note 9 4G, here’s what to expect from the upcoming Redmi 9 Power.

Xiaomi Redmi 9 Power expected specifications

Xiaomi Redmi 9 Power design leaked

The Redmi 9 Power could likely feature the same 6.53-inch Full HD+ (2340 x 1080 pixels) resolution display as the Redmi Note 9 4G. The screen has a waterdrop notch for the selfie camera and is topped with a layer of Gorilla Glass 3. The phone is expected to have a new design with the brand’s name slapped on the back panel. The phone measures 9.6 millimetres and weighs 198 grams.

The Redmi 9 Power is confirmed to be powered by a Qualcomm Snapdragon processor and it is likely the Snapdragon 662 under the hood. The chipset has an octa-core CPU, Adreno 610 GPU and is paired with upto 8GB RAM and 256GB storage options. The storage is also expandable by adding a microSD card and it runs on MIUI 12 out-of-the-box.

The phone has a quad-camera setup on the back with a 48MP primary camera, an 8MP ultra-wide-angle camera, 2MP depth sensor and a macro camera. On the front, there is an 8MP selfie camera housed within the waterdrop notch.

The Redmi 9 Power is expected to arrive with 6,000mAh battery with support for 18W fast charging.

Concept video shows off Xiaomis ambitious rollable smartphone render

After LG and Oppo, now Xiaomi looks like it's working on a smartphone with a rollable display. A patent filed by Xiaomi last year hinted that the company might start its rollable smartphone project soon. This design patent surfaced on both USPTO (United States Patent and Trademark Office) and WIPO (World Intellectual Property Office). We don't have an update on the progress yet, but the patent has now been used by Jermaine Smit (aka Concept Creator on YouTube) in partnership with Letsgodigital to make a set of renders that shows the concept in action. 

The patent shows a retractable display that can stretch sideways to take tablet form. It comes with a wraparound panel which was also seen on the Mi Mix Alpha concept, although the render looks to be a slightly better version of the technology.

In the renders, the concept is called the Mi Mix Alpha R, it looks sleek and very different from other rollable phone concepts we've seen. The display stretches from the front to the back of the phone making it an all-screen phone. Its display rolls out horizontally and extends a large area to use. The sides are completely curved, and there is even a 3.5mm headphone jack included here.

Although the render of Xiaomi's phone with a wraparound display is out, note that the device still looks far from reality unless Xiaomi confirms it. We do not know when the phone will become a reality and how will it look. However, if we go by speculations, the phone may become a reality in the first half of 2021. 

As we mentioned, Oppo has also shown off its concept rollable smartphone recently, called the Oppo X 2021. While it won't be available commercially anytime soon, it is a working model, which technically makes it the first working rollable smartphone in the world.

Apart from Oppo, LG is also expected to announce its rollable smartphone in the first half of 2021 and it's said to go on sale before Oppo's offering. None of the developments come with concrete proof, but what's confirmed is that rollable smartphones are coming in 2021.

The Mi Watch Lite makes an appearance on Mis Global website

The new Xiaomi watch, called the Mi Watch Lite, was spotted on Mi’s Global website. It looks like the Redmi watch that was launched in China last month. The watch listed on mi.com has all the details and specifications of the device but it does not give any details about pricing or availability of the watch.

Specifications:

The Mi Watch Lite comes with a 1.4-inch colour display with a resolution of 320 x 320 pixels that comes with auto-brightness adjustment and a pixel density of 323 ppi. The 230mAh battery charges in almost 2hours and can stay powered up-to 9-days on a single charge. The watch features 11 workout modes including Swimming, Cricket, Trekking, Running, and Walking.

The watch comes with 5atm water resistance which allows you to wear the watch while swimming. It also comes with heart monitoring, sleep tracking, and guided breathing modes to help alleviate stress levels. The watch also has call and chat notifications, music control, phone finder, and weather report among other features.

The watch features GPS, A-GPS, GLONASS, Barometer, and compass to track your trajectory, speed, distance, and calories burnt. The Android users will need to download the Xiaomi Wear app while the iOS user will need to download the Xiaomi Wear lite app to connect the watch to their smartphones and access all the features.

Pricing and Options:

The watch comes with three different cases and five different coloured bands options to choose from. Given the price of Redmi watch at CNY 299 (roughly Rs. 3,300), we can expect similar pricing for the Mi Watch Lite in global markets.

TikTok beats Facebook, Whatsapp to become the most downloaded app in 2020

TikTok has overtaken Facebook to become the most downloaded app in 2020. Despite facing a hard time in its key markets India and the USA, the viral short video app has shown immense growth number in the last two years. TikTok also leapt 15 spots to become the second-highest revenue-generating app for “consumer spend” behind Tinder. The app is expected to hit 130 billion iOS and Android downloads with global spending forecasted to hit $112 billion this year iOS.

As per App Annie's annual trend report, TikTok has earned the most downloaded app followed by Facebook at the second spot. Compared to last year's ranking, TikTok has moved three positions upwards taking over WhatsApp, Facebook and Facebook Messenger. In 2019, four of the top five most downloaded Facebook-owned apps dominated the rankings, with TikTok finding a place at number four. 

This year, though, Zoom has surprised everyone with its entry at number four, jumping 219 positions up the list. Last year's most downloaded app Facebook Messenger moved at number six where Facebook, WhatsApp and Instagram held to their spots at number two, three and five respectively. However, Facebook’s apps still make up the top four apps in terms of monthly active users.

The report is based on combined results from App Store and Google Play till November 2020, with the iOS results only reflecting for China.

A roller coaster year for TikTok

TikTok has shown immense growth in the last two years, but it has not come as easy for the Chinese company. While users around the world went berserk over the short video app, its country of origin has irked the state, especially in India and the US, the two key markets.

While the Indian government has banned TikTok in the country concerning national security, the Trump administration has put several hurdles citing privacy issues, which is now halted after Biden took over the presidency. TikTok's future in these countries look murky, but the report suggests that the app is still growing at a rapid pace globally.
